I have done the sums many times for many people, no matter how I work it it ALWAYS works out cheaper to sell the RB25 cylinder head and excessories and buy an RB26 cylinder head. By the time you do the inlet manifiold, cams (RB26 cams are always cheaper), pulleys, bypass the VVT, lifters, valve springs, valves and then injectors (top feed are always cheaper), the fuel rail (the standard RB26 rail is good for over 650 bhp) etc etc.

Then you have the fact that the end result (of a hybrid RB25 cylinder head) is never as good a full RB26 top end.
